Dr. Doron BarDr. Doron Bar is an historical-Geographer, a graduate of the department of geography in the Hebrew University in Jerusalem. Dr. Bar wrote and edited several books and articles about the historical-geography of Palestine (Eretz Israel) during Late Antiquity. He is also interested in the creation of holy space and in the phenomenon of pilgrimage in both antiquity and 19th and 20th centuries. His work examines the ways in which pilgrimage and holy space influenced Palestine's geography through history.


Dr. Jackie Feldman is a senior lecturer in anthropology at Ben Gurion University, Beersheba and holds a doctorate in Religious Studies from Hebrew University. He has published scholarly articles on Christian pilgrimage, Second Temple Pilgrimage, and a book on youth voyages to Poland, and has worked as a licensed guide for Christian pilgrims to the Holy Land. His fields of interest are pilgrimage and tourism, anthropology of Christianity, collective memory and ritual.
